So here is the thing. YOU are their parent for a reason. They are your child for a reason. YOU are meant to parent according to your strengths and personality. Yes it is valuable to have some knowledge about children, some mentors who guide you, some people you follow who you jive and connect with. YOU ARE THE EXPERT ON YOUR CHILD. You have the intuition, love and emotions to guide you. I also am a woman of faith and believe that God knows this child better than I do, that these children are on loan from him and that I can gain inspiration as I listen and rely on him. Whether you are a person of faith or not, I still believe there is a power in the universe you can gain inspiration and guidance from.
I remember when I took a course on creating a business, the teacher said to not collect coaches. To really find those who spoke to me, and get rid of some of the noise. Maybe if you’re having a hard time finding answers for your child, there’s too much noise in your mind. Maybe you need to get quiet, tune into that inspiration, focus on your relationship with your child and take things a step at a time. Sometimes when theres so many voices and so many conflicting experts it doesn’t allow us to tune into ourselves.
